Adrenal and Gonad Early Development
The key events of molecular development of steroidogenic tissues in mice are shown in this cartoon. Dax-1 function in sex determination is still unclear.
- male sex - SRY, SOX9, SF-1, Dax-1
- female sex - Wnt4, Dax-1
Steroidogenic Factor 1
- 53 kDa protein called Ad4BP (Adrenal 4 Binding Protein) or SF-1 (Steroidogenic Factor 1)
- classical DNA-binding domain (DBD) characterized by two Cys2-Cys2 zinc fingers in the N-terminal region
- SF-1 binds DNA as a monomer
- high homology with the drosophila Ftz-F1 transcription factor that controls fushi tarazu homeotic gene expression
